Abstract:
A geographical information system and a method are disclosed for geospatially mapping at least one parcel polygon within a geographical region and for displaying at least one specific attribute of each parcel polygon, i.e. a topological area within the given geographical region, as an attached attribute of latitude and longitude coordinates. The centroid or center point of each of the parcel polygons is determined and stored into conventional computer storage means. The latitude and longitude point feature at the centroid of each parcel polygon is established and similarly stored. A unique tax identification number, e.g. the Assessor Parcel Number (APN) or Parcel Identifier Number (PIN), is assigned to each of the point features. A correlation is then made between the unique tax identification number of the point feature to a text list of at least one attribute, e.g., the physical address of the parcel polygon, of each of the point features. This attribute becomes attached to each point feature. The resulting parcel polygon map and point features with one or more of the attached attributes can then be displayed within a GIS or CAD system to provide the user, for example, accurate locations of street addresses for use in environments that require pinpoint accuracy, such as emergency response.
